从GitHub安装nuget包

时间:2016-01-13 07:29:15

标签: git visual-studio nuget nuget-package package-managers

命令:Install-Package curve25519-uwp 安装此软件包的版本1.0.3(https://www.nuget.org/packages/curve25519-uwp/

在GitHub上有一个版本1.0.4修复了我面临的特定错误。

任何人都可以解释如何安装该软件包吗?

我正在使用安装了git工具的visual studio 2015社区版。

1 个答案:

答案 0 :(得分:16)

使用NuGet,无法从Git存储库中获取预版本。

你可以:

  1. 要求发布新版本的NuGet软件包,或至少预发布版本。

  2. 克隆存储库,构建版本,并使用本地依赖项替换NuGet包。 (不是一个好的解决方案!)

  3. 与上述类似,但将其放在您自己的NuGet服务器中。

  4. 将存储库作为Git子模块进行管理。

  5. 从NuGet切换到Paket,它支持对Git存储库的引用。 (如果你的案子经常出现,肯定是最好的解决办法。)